2011年9月计算机二级《VF》考前冲刺试卷(5)

如果您发现本试卷没有包含本套题的全部小题,请尝试在页面顶部本站内搜索框搜索相关题目,一般都能找到。
17

第 33 题 连编应用程序不能生成的文件是(  )。

  • A).app文件
  • B).exe文件
  • C).dll文件
  • D).prg文件
19

第 32 题 查询所有目前年龄在25岁以下(不含25岁)的职工信息(姓名、性别和年龄),正确的命令是(  )。

  • A)SELECT姓名,性别,YEAR(DATE())-YEAR(出生日期)年龄FROM职工;&nbsp;&nbsp;&nbsp;&nbsp;WHERE年龄<25
  • B)SELECT姓名,性别,YEAR(DATE())-YEAR(出生日期)年龄FROM职工;&nbsp;&nbsp;&nbsp;&nbsp;WHERE YEAR(出生日期)<25
  • C)SELECT姓名,性别,YEAR(DATE())-YEAR(出生日期)年龄FROM职工;&nbsp;&nbsp;&nbsp;&nbsp;WHERE YEAR(DATE()).YEAR(出生日期)<25
  • D)SELECT姓名,性别,年龄=YEAR(DATE())-YEAR(出生日期)FROM职工;&nbsp;&nbsp;&nbsp;&nbsp;WHERE YEAR(DATE())一YEAR(出生日期)<25
20

第 31~33 使用如下三个表:

部门.dbf:部门号C(8),部门名C(12),负责人C(6)

职工.dbf:部门号C(8),职工号C(10),姓名C(8),性别C(2),出生日期D(8)

工资.dbf:职工号C(10),基本工资N(8.2),津贴N(8.2),奖金N(8.2)

第 31 题 查询每个部门年龄最小者的信息,要求得到的信息包括部门名和最长者的出生日期。正确的命令是(  )。

  • A)SELECT部门名,MIN(出生日期)FROM部门JOIN职工:&nbsp;&nbsp;&nbsp;&nbsp;WHERE部门.部门号=职工.部门号GROUP BY部门名
  • B)SELECT部门名,MIN(出生日期)FROM部门JOIN职工:&nbsp;&nbsp;&nbsp;&nbsp;ON部门.部门号=职工.部门号GROUP BY部门名
  • C)SELECT部门名,MAX(出生日期)FROM部门JOIN职工:&nbsp;&nbsp;&nbsp;&nbsp;ON部门.部门号=职工.部门号GROUP BY部门名
  • D)SELECT部门名,MAX(出生日期)FROM部门JOIN职工:
21

第 29 题 下面有关视图的描述,正确的是(  )。

  • A)可以使用MODIFYSTRUCTURE命令修改视图的结构’
  • B)视图不能删除,否则影响原来的数据文件
  • C)视图是对表的复制产生的
  • D)使用SQL对视图进行查询时,必须事先打开该视图所在的数据库
22

第 30 题 向“仓库”表中新增一个“人数”字段,数据类型为数值型,宽度为2,正确的命令语句是(  )。

  • A)CREATE TABLE 仓库 ALTER 人数 N(2)
  • B)CREATE TABLE 仓库 ADD FIELDS 人数 N(2)
  • C)ALTER TABLE 仓库 ALTER 人数 N(2)
  • D)ALTER TABLE 仓库 ADD 人数 N(2)
24

如果学生表student是使用下面的SQL语句创建的

CREATE TABLE student(学号C(4)PRIMARY KEY NOT NULL,;

姓名C(8),;

性别C(2),;

年龄N(2)CHECK(年龄>1 5 AND年龄<30))

下面的SQL语句中可以正确执行的是(  )。

  • A.INSERT INTO student(学号,性别,年龄)VALUES(“0542”,”男”,17)
  • B.INSERT INTO student(姓名,性别,年龄VALUES(“李蕾”,”女”,20)
  • C.INSERT INTO student(姓名,性别,年龄)VALUES(“男”,25)
  • D.INSERT INTO student(学号,姓名)VALUES(“0897”,“安宁”,16)
25

第 27 题 查询“成绩”表的所有记录并存储于数组arrl中的SQL语句是(  )。

  • A)SELECT﹡FROM成绩INTO ARRAY arrl
  • B)SELECT﹡FROM成绩TO CURSOR arrl
  • C)SELECT﹡FROM成绩TO ARRAY arrl
  • D)SELECT﹡FROM成绩INTO CURSOR arrl
27

第 25 题 以下是与设置系统菜单有关的命令,错误的是(  )。

  • A)SETSYSMENUNOSAVE
  • B)SETSYSMENUSAVE
  • C)SETSYSMENUTODEFAULT
  • D)SETSYSMENUDEFAULT
28

第 23 题 要为当前打开的“成绩”表中所有的“分数”增加5分,可以使用命令(  )。

  • A)UPDATE成绩WITH分数+5
  • B)CHANGE ALL分数WITH分数+5
  • C)DISPLAYALL分数WHH分数+5
  • D)REPLACE ALL分数WITH分数+5
29

第 22 题 如果指定参照完整性的删除规则为“级联”,则当删除父表中的记录时(  )。

  • A)若子表中有相关记录,则禁止删除父表中记录
  • B)不作参照完整性检查,删除父表记录与子表无关
  • C)系统自动备份父表中被删除记录到一个新表中
  • D)会自动删除子表中所有相关记录
33

第 18 题 下列对于SQL的嵌套查询排序的描述中,说法正确的是(  )。

  • A)既能对外层查询排序,也能对内层查询排序
  • B)只能对外层查询排序,不能对内层查询排序
  • C)不能对外层查询排序,只能对内层查询排序
  • D)既不能对外层查询排序,也不能对内层查询排序
36

第 15 题 当前目录下有“学生”表和“成绩”表两个文件,要求查找同时选修了“课程名称”为“计算机”和“英语”的学生姓名,下列SQL语句的空白处应填入的语句为(  )。

SELECT姓名FROM学生,成绩;

WHERE学生.学号=成绩.学号;

  • AND课程名称=”计算机”;
  • AND姓名__;&nbsp;&nbsp;&nbsp;&nbsp;(SELECT姓名FROM学生,成绩;&nbsp;&nbsp;&nbsp;&nbsp;WHERE学生.学号=成绩.学号;
  • AND课程名称=”英语”)&nbsp;&nbsp;&nbsp;&nbsp;<IMG src="//img1.yqda.net/question-name/52/c4e3c197f5f0f48b8275f3c3c8d08e.gif" border=0>
39

第 11 题 关于容器,以下叙述中错误的是(  )。

  • A)容器可以包含其他控件
  • B)不同的容器所能包含的对象类型都是相同的
  • C)容器可以包含其他容器
  • D)不同的容器所能包含的对象类型是不相同的
42

第 10 题 下面的SQL语句能实现的功能是(  )。

SELECT宰FROM学生WHERE班级号=”0801”:

UNION;

SELECT牛FROM学生WHERE班级号=”0802”

  • A)查询在0801班或0802班的学生信息
  • B)查询0801班或0802班的班级信息
  • C)查询既在0801班又在0802班的学生信息
  • D)语句错误,不能执行
43

第 8 题 在VisualFoxPro中,如果在表之间的联系中设置了参照完整性规则,并在删除规则中选择了“限制”,当删除父表记录时,系统的反应是(  )。

  • A)不做参照完整性检查
  • B)不准删除父表中的记录
  • C)自动删除子表中所有相关记录
  • D)若子表中有相关记录,则禁止删除父表中记录
44

第 7 题 在学生表中共有100条记录,执行如下命令,执行结果将是(  )

INDEX ON.总分TO ZF

SETINDEXTOZF

GO TOP

DISPLAY

  • A)显示的记录号是1
  • B)显示分数最高的记录号
  • C)显示的记录号是100
  • D)显示分数最低的记录号
50

第 1 题 命令SELECT 0的功能是(  )。

  • A)选择编号最小的未使用工作区
  • B)选择0号工作区
  • C)关闭当前工作区中的表
  • D)选择当前工作区